Heard of Free Rice (http://www.freerice.com)?
It's an educational gaming site devoted to two things- making us a bit smarter, and feeding people in poor or natural-disaster struck areas. Practice a foreign language (French, Spanish, Italian, German, and English), chemistry, geography, art history, or math, and for every question you get right, 10 grains of rice are donated! They're currently sending rice to Haiti and Sri Lanka.
Anyway, they make rice acquisition a contest. Groups compete to get on the leader-boards, and there's also the feeling of knowing that your trivia prowess is actually used for something good! I set up a Telltale Community group, the Freelance Rice Police (http://www.freerice.com/content-group/telltale-community-freelance-rice-police), for anyone who wants to help fight the crime that is malnourishment!
Oh, yeah... and since I forgot to mention it- Free Rice is free to play. The advertisers and donors pay for it. You on't pay anything other than your time!

As Jedexodus said, the only way they earn the money is through advertisements, and no one wants to advertise a website that no one goes to, even if it is for charity, so they add the questions, and make it sortof like a game, then people play it, the word spreads, then the advertisors realize how popular the website is, and pays them to put the advertisements there, then they have the money for the rice.
